curl to Python Converter — curl to requests

Convert curl command to Python requests code. Ready-to-run script.

curl to Python Converter: Convert curl command to Python requests code. Ready-to-run script. Handles format translation for migration, integration, and cross-system data exchange without manual rewriting. Runs entirely in your browser — nothing is uploaded or stored. Part of the API Tools toolkit on HttpStatus.com.

Frequently Asked Questions

Does curl to Python Converter preserve all data during conversion?

Values and structure are preserved. Format-specific features (like comments) that don't exist in the target format are dropped.

Is my input collected for analytics?

No — client-side tools don't transmit your input. Standard page-view analytics may run, but your data is never included.

Does this work offline?

After the initial page load, yes — all processing is local. You need connectivity to load the page itself.

Is my data saved after I close the tab?

No. Client-side tools don't persist input. Once you close or navigate away, your data is gone.

More Api tools Tools

Explore Other Tool Hubs